Quinoa Crunch Chia Pudding

Preparation time: 5 minutes - Servings: 1

Ingredients

  • 40g (¼ cup) chia seeds

  • 300ml milk of choice (dairy / almond / coconut)

  • 1 tbsp (15ml) maple syrup or honey

  • 1 tsp of vanilla extract

  • 10g pea protein (optional)

  • 20g Homespun Quinoa Crunch (

  • 1 - 2 tsp nut butter for drizzling

  • Fruit of your choice to sprinkle on top

Directions

  1. Mix together the milk, chia seeds, vanilla extract and maple syrup in a jug or bowl. Let the mix sit for 5 minutes and whisk again. This is to help avoid the mixture clumping and sticking together.

  2. If using the pea protein blend it into the milk before mixing it with the chia seeds.

  3. Cover the pudding and place in the fridge for 3 hours or overnight. If possible, check it after an initial 30 minutes chilling time to give it one more whisk before letting it rest!

  4. Stir well before serving. If the pudding appears too thick just add a drop more milk to thin it out.

  5. Sprinkle with your Homespun Quinoa Crunch of your choice for a delicious boost before adding a drizzle of nut butter and some chopped or sliced fresh fruit or berries.
